Festive Holiday Candles

Simple beeswax rolling kits offer fun for all ages

Did you know that once, during the Victorian era, people would place candles directly on their Christmas trees? Affixed with a bit of melted wax and some metal pins, the candles were glued to the branches and then set alight to create a spectacular glow.
